Connecting to Us Couples Retreat

Is it time to re-invest in and revitalize your relationship?

Picture
Often we take our most precious asset, our partner, for granted. In hectic, stressful, troubled times, the quality of our relationships is more important than ever.
 
We long for a deep connection with our partner.  Yet, so often our self-limiting habits, work stresses, or years of just plain neglect, sidetrack our dream for deep intimacy and loving partnership.
 
When you invest in your most intimate relationship, everything works and everyone benefits. For your happiness, this might just be the most important work you’ll ever do as a couple.

  • What's in it for you:  Deeper connection, intimate communication, freedom from distraction, honest sharing, enhanced trust, romance, play, visioning and dreaming…
 
  • When is it: Friday, July 14, 7:00 p.m. – Sunday, July 16, 3:00 p.m.
 
  • Where is it: Alexandria, Pennsylvania, at the Edgewater Inn and Riverside Grille, a peaceful country Inn situated on 16 acres along the beautiful Frankstown Branch of the Juniata River in the South Central Mountains of Pennsylvania.
 
What you can expect

The retreat can accommodate a maximum of 12 couples. You will be given exercises to do alone or with your partner. Confidentiality is respected and preserved throughout the weekend.

Meet your Retreat Leaders


Picture
Andrew L. Miser, Ph.D.

​Andrew L. Miser Ph.D. is a Certified Professional Coach trained through the Coaches Training Institute. He is a
member of the American Psychological Association, the American Association of Marriage and Family Therapy, and the International Coaches Federation.

In his work with couples, he brings expertise in adult developmental, marital education, and experiential learning. He works with couples in exploring their values, in creating a vision for their lives and in developing an effective and fulfilling partnership. He is the author of The Partnership Marriage, Creating a Life You Love…Together.

Picture
Introducing Brian Bassett,
​Professional Dance Instructor

 
Brian’s teaching experience began in 1961 in and around Stoneham, Massachusetts, north of Boston. His wife, Sharon, became his teaching partner in 1977, with the additional expert tutelage of his parents, Jack and Alma Bassett, in Boalsburg, Pennsylvania.
 
In 1979, Brian and Sharon began teaching under the name Bassett Dance Studio and have offered private and semi-private lessons in their home studio at 10724 Bassett Lane, Petersburg, since 1986.
 
The Bassetts have extensive experience, travelling around the country, teaching ballroom and round dancing to couples. teaching ballroom and round dancing to couples.
